Here is a simple breakdown of how to buy it when it becomes available.



First, you need a stockbroking account. This is where your investments will be processed and managed. Without it, you cannot participate in any IPO on the Nigerian Exchange.



Second, fund your trading account. You can transfer money from your bank account into your stockbroker wallet so you are ready when the IPO opens.



Third, watch out for the official IPO announcement. The offer price, date of subscription, and number of shares will be clearly stated by the exchange and your broker.



Fourth, place your subscription order through your stockbroker or trading app once the IPO is open. You simply select the quantity of shares you want and submit.



Fifth, wait for allocation. If demand is high, you may receive partial shares based on how the IPO is structured.



This is how IPO investing works in simple terms.
